4 Cumberland Close, Twickenham, TW1 1RS is a leasehold flat built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 893 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£512,475 , which equates to approximately £574 per square foot. It was last sold on 16 Oct 2025 for £530,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£17,525, representing a 3.3% decrease, or approximately 4.9% per year.

The current estimated value of £512,475 is:

  • 5.4% higher than the average property price on Cumberland Close
  • 4.1% lower than the average in the TW1 1RS postcode area
  • and 37.8% lower than the average price for Twickenham as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 5 July 2010,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

4 Cumberland Close, Twickenham, Richmond Upon Thames, Greater London Authority, TW1 1RS has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 30 Jun 2020.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from the main heating system, though the cylinder has no thermostat.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 5 Jul 2010. The rating of D is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 11.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from average to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The hot water system was changed from from main system to from main system, no cylinder thermostat, with its energy efficiency changing from average to poor.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 150 mm loft insulation to pitched, 200 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 37%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 62%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from average to good.

Flood risk from rivers and the sea

This property has very low flood risk from rivers and the sea.

River and sea flooding includes flooding caused by overflowing rivers, estuaries, tidal waters and coastal surges.

Flood risk from surface water

This property has very low surface water flood risk.

Surface water flooding can happen when heavy rainfall overwhelms drains, roads, gardens or other hard surfaces.
